Howdy! The Rochester 2 bl was/is a popular carb swap. I had one on my 72 FJ40. Worked good. Tune up parts and settings were usually based on mid 60s chevy 6 banger pickup trucks. I always used 1966 and never had a problem. Rebuild is easy and parts should be common in most stores. It could be you can get it running faster than you can figure out the weber. John
